Cheapest Available Sunset Valley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Sunset Valley area of Austin, TX is a Studio unit found at Mission James Place Apartments priced from $884. Tramor at Hunter's Glen has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$995. Here are the most affordable Sunset Valley apartments for rent in Austin, TX:

Best Value Apartments for Rent in Sunset Valley, TX

As of March 29, 2025 the best value apartment in the Sunset Valley area is the $1.61 price per square foot B1 Model at Trillium Terrace in the in the Southeast Austin neighborhood starting from $1,553. The second greatest value Sunset Valley apartment is the Legislator Model at Barton Creek Landing starting at $1,673 with a $1.84 price per square foot in the Zilker neighborhood. Here is today’s list of the best values for Sunset Valley apartments based on price per square foot:
